Safety medicine dissolving device
Technical field
This utility model relates to technical field of medical instruments, particularly a kind of medicine dissolving and adding utensil.
Background technology
At present, venous transfusion and injection are treatment meanss the most frequently used in the medical treatment.Before infusing, often need some powder and liquid of glucose or liquor is formulated together.Concrete operational approach is: syringe is inserted extract a spot of medicinal liquid in the medicinal liquid bottle; Extract syringe then and insert in the powdered medicine bottle, medicinal liquid is injected powdered medicine bottle; After treating that medicated powder and medicinal liquid dissolve fully, extract mixed liquor again out and inject in infusion bottle or the direct suction injection tube.In the above process of making up a prescription,,, operation is required great effort very much so can produce certain draught head when operating because medicine bottle is hermetically-sealed construction.
The application number that the inventor proposes is: 012541443 utility application " Medicine adder for injection " is just at technical solution that this problem provided.This Medicine adder for injection is socket needle tubing and a needle tubing seat outside syringe needle, and needle tubing is fixed on the needle tubing seat, and needle tubing seat and needle holder are fixed together, and the sidepiece of needle tubing seat is provided with blow vent.The supporting use of this Medicine adder for injection and syringe utilizes in the space of air between syringe needle and needle tubing and circulates, and keeps the inside and outside air pressure balance of medicine bottle, and is very laborsaving when therefore operating, and can increase work efficiency.
But when reality was used above-mentioned Medicine adder for injection, the inventor found that this product also exists certain weak point.Main cause is in the process of making up a prescription, and when lysate or medicinal liquid, owing to delineate bottleneck with grinding wheel, the glass fragment that produces when cracking bottleneck is fallen in the medicine bottle easily in extracting ampoule bottle; Solid medicated powder is when making up a prescription dissolving, because the operating time is short, the deliquescent difference of solid medicated powder, has the part granule to fail to dissolve; Simultaneously, when drug feeding device puncture rubber, easily make the rubber stopper breakage, produce rubber scraps and enter in the medicinal liquid.Like this, when using Medicine adder for injection to extract medicinal liquid, glass fragment, part medicated powder granule or rubber scraps also are drawn into.When carrying out venous transfusion or injection to patient, these chips or granule directly enter in the blood of human body, with blood circulation meeting artery-clogging, bring harm to patient body, even threat to life.When carrying out intramuscular injection to patient, these granules and chip can stimulate the muscle of injection site, bring painful sensation to patient.
Summary of the invention
The purpose of this utility model is at the existing above-mentioned defective of existing medicine dissolving and adding utensil; a kind of safety medicine dissolving device is provided; make that it is not only easy to use, prevent that airborne pathogen and dust particle from entering in the medicinal liquid; and prevent that solid particles such as medicated powder, glass fragment or rubber scraps from entering institute's vehicle and enter in the patient body, guarantee that patient safety uses.
The purpose of this utility model has adopted following technical proposal to realize: the safety medicine dissolving device comprises needle holder and the syringe needle that is fixed on the needle holder, liquid outlet is arranged on the needle holder, liquid-through hole is arranged in the syringe needle, outer socket needle tubing of syringe needle and needle tubing seat, needle tubing is fixed on the needle tubing seat, certain space is arranged between syringe needle and the needle tubing, needle tubing seat and needle holder are fixed together, the sidepiece of needle tubing seat is provided with blow vent, one deck air filtration film is set in the blow vent, and the front portion of needle tubing is provided with passage, and the needle holder center is a cavity that supplies medicinal liquid to pass through, the terminal of the liquid outlet of needle holder and syringe needle all communicates with cavity, and one deck liquid medicine filtering membrane is set in cavity.
In structure of the present utility model; except avoiding by the air filtration film airborne microgranule enters; also the liquid medicine filtering membrane by being provided with in needle holder enters in the infusion bottle glass fragment, medicated powder or rubber scraps in the medicinal liquid, can use safely to guarantee the patient.
Above-mentioned liquid medicine filtering membrane can with the vertical direction setting of syringe needle.Liquid medicine filtering membrane is separated into two chambers up and down with the cavity of needle holder, and these two chambers communicate with the liquid outlet of needle holder and the liquid-through hole of syringe needle respectively.Medicinal liquid enters upper chamber by the liquid-through hole of syringe needle, behind liquid medicine filtering membrane, by lower chambers to liquid outlet.
Another kind of mode is the liquid medicine filtering membrane direction setting parallel with syringe needle, two chambers about liquid medicine filtering membrane is divided into the cavity of needle holder at this moment.These two chambers communicate with the liquid outlet of needle holder and the liquid-through hole of syringe needle respectively.
Compared with prior art; this utility model is owing to adopted the mode of double filtration; therefore in the process of making up a prescription, not only meet hygienic requirements fully, and can prevent that glass fragment, medicated powder granule or rubber scraps from entering in infusion bottle or the syringe, guarantees that patient safety uses reliably.

The specific embodiment
As depicted in figs. 1 and 2, the safety medicine dissolving device that provides of this utility model comprises syringe needle 1, needle holder 2, needle tubing 3, needle tubing seat 4, air filtration film 5 and liquid medicine filtering membrane 7 etc.Syringe needle 1 and needle holder 2 are close with common structure.In Fig. 1, the liquid-through hole 10 aperture 10a of syringe needle 1 are positioned at syringe needle 1 front end.The liquid-through hole 10 aperture 10a of syringe needle 1 also can be positioned at the sidepiece of syringe needle 1 front end, and structure as shown in Figure 2 is used for preventing that inserting the rubber stopper process at syringe needle 1 produces chip.Needle tubing 3 is fixed in the needle tubing seat 4, and needle tubing 3 is enclosed within the outside of syringe needle 1.But between needle tubing 3 and the syringe needle 1 certain clearance is arranged, this gap passes through for air.In the present embodiment, it is that material is made that syringe needle 1 all adopts rustless steel with needle tubing 3, and needle holder 2 and needle tubing seat 4 adopt plastics to make.Passage 30 is arranged on the needle tubing 3.
As depicted in figs. 1 and 2, the sidepiece of needle tubing seat 4 has blow vent 6, is provided with one deck air filtration film 5 in the blow vent 6.Air filtration film 5 can adopt hydrophobic membrane or examine empty film is that material is made.
The center of needle holder 2 is a cavity 21, and one deck liquid medicine filtering membrane 7 is set in the cavity 21.As shown in Figure 1, in embodiment one, liquid medicine filtering membrane 7 and syringe needle 1 vertical direction setting, i.e. horizontally set.
As shown in Figure 2, liquid medicine filtering membrane 7 has adopted another kind of mode to be provided with, i.e. the parallel direction setting of liquid medicine filtering membrane 7 and syringe needle 1.At this moment, as shown in Figure 3, liquid medicine filtering membrane 7 is separated into two chambers with the cavity 21 of needle holder 2, and each communicates the liquid outlet 20 of needle holder 2 and the end of syringe needle 1 with one of them chamber.After adopting this mode, the area of liquid medicine filtering membrane 7 can make bigger, is beneficial to improve the rate of filtration.
Common and the supporting use of syringe of safety medicine dissolving device.When extracting medicinal liquid, air by blow vent 6 by the space between air filtration film 5 and syringe needle 1 and the needle tubing 3 after, enter in the medicinal liquid bottle through passage 30.Medicinal liquid then by the liquid-through hole 10 of syringe needle 1 behind the cavity 21 of needle holder 2, enter in the injection tube from liquid outlet 20.Through needle holder 2 places the time, medicinal liquid will be by the filtration of liquid medicine filtering membrane 7.Therefore, can not contain granules such as undissolved medicated powder or rubber scraps in the last employed medicinal liquid of patient.Show that through actual detected medicinal liquid is by behind this liquid medicine filtering membrane 7, its rejection rate reaches more than 90%.
The material of this liquid medicine filtering membrane 7 can adopt fibrous membrane or examine empty film and make.
